    Great video, 9:02 the line diverging to the right here hasn’t seen traffic for around 25 years and is very overgrown- rails are still in excellent condition though and go all the way up to Brynmenyn with semaphore signals/levers and many structures intact along the way- strange how none of it has been lifted after all this time

    I used this line a few years after it reopened and was very surprised at how busy the train was. It reminded me how shortsighted line closures were in the 1960s and what demand there is for decent public transport away from cities. I'm sure there must be dozens of lines around the UK that if reopened would be great successes. Meanwhile politicians and civil servants often downplay or sabotage reopening possibilities with overly conservative traffic estimates. In Scotland, both the new Alloa branch and the new Borders Railway now have traffic levels several times that forecast!

  • @stevevince5981

    @stevevince5981

    3 жыл бұрын

    To be fair, at the time lines like this were closed, most people in the towns they served worked locally and didn't use the trains. Now that the jobs are all in Cardiff, there's a demand which in the 60s and 70s there just wasn't.
